Mahatma memorial to grace Washington park
Mahatma Gandhi never visited the United States, much less Washington DC, but the city will soon be imbued with the spirit of the Great Soul. President Clinton signed on Monday a bill cleared by the Congress approving construction of a memorial for Mahatma Gandhi.

Boat mishap in Assam kills 40
At least forty persons, mostly young children are feared dead in a tragic boat mishap on the Brahmaputra in the heart of Guwahati early Tuesday morning. The accident took place when two boats, both carrying Bihari pilgrims who had gone to take the holy dip in the Brahmaputra on the occasion of Chhat Puja, collided about 50 metres from the Sukleswar ghat at around 5:30 a.m.

Pak bid to capture Siachen post foiled
Pakistani troops suffered at least six casualties when Indian troops repulsed their attempt to capture a northern post at the Siachen glacier on Tuesday morning. This is the second unsuccessful attempt by Pakistani troops to capture Indian post in Siachen glacier in the last eight days.
